Features
- Agentless, application-centric backup and restore for Kubernetes workloads, including containers, VMs, Helm charts, and operators.
- Native, agentless backup and disaster recovery for OpenStack environments, capturing VMs, Cinder volumes, network configurations, and metadata.
- Continuous data protection with near-zero Recovery Point Objective (RPO) and rapid Recovery Time Objective (RTO) capabilities.
- Application mobility features enabling seamless migration of applications and their data between different Kubernetes clusters and cloud environments.
- Support for metadata transformations to facilitate migrations across diverse infrastructure, including storage class adjustments and network configuration updates.
- Integration with CI/CD pipelines and orchestration tools like Ansible and ArgoCD for automated backup and restore workflows.
- Immutable backup options and standard format backups (e.g., QCOW2) for enhanced ransomware protection.
- Self-service backup and restore capabilities for tenants, reducing the burden on IT administration teams.
- Support for multiple OpenStack distributions (e.g., Red Hat OpenStack Platform, Mirantis OpenStack) and Kubernetes distributions (e.g., Red Hat OpenShift, Mirantis Kubernetes Engine, EKS, AKS, GKE).
- Granular recovery options, allowing for the restoration of individual resources, files, or entire workloads.
